**Body of Missing American Student Found in Barcelona**
The body of James "Jimmy" Gracey, a 20-year-old University of Alabama student, was found in the water off a Barcelona beach on Thursday. The discovery was made by police divers who positively identified the remains. Gracey had been missing since Tuesday, when he failed to return to his Airbnb after visiting friends at a nightclub.
Gracey, a member of the Theta Chi fraternity, was serving as chaplain for the school's chapter and had also taken on the role of philanthropy chairperson. He was on spring break in Spain, visiting friends who were studying abroad. His mother, Therese Marren Gracey, had posted on Facebook on Tuesday, expressing concern for her son's safety. "My college-aged son is visiting friends who are studying abroad," she wrote. "The police have his phone, but he never made it back to his Airbnb."
According to Cavin McLay, the president of the Theta Chi fraternity, Gracey had been with a group at the nightclub when they got separated. "That was the last time they saw him," McLay said. He added that about 10 people from the fraternity were in Barcelona, visiting friends who were studying abroad. McLay is currently in Barcelona but was not staying with the same group of friends as Gracey.
Gracey's body was found near the Shoko restaurant and nightclub, where he was last seen on Tuesday morning. Catalan police are continuing to investigate the cause of death. The Gracey family has released a statement, asking for prayers and privacy. "Our family is heartbroken as we confirm that Jimmy's body has been recovered in Barcelona," the statement read. "Jimmy was a deeply loved son, grandson, brother, nephew, cousin, and friend, and our family is struggling to come to terms with this unimaginable loss."
